I know it's not a honda, but it's FI and cool anyway.


This is my buddies evo, he owns Vishnu performance. I guess this is their stage 2 package. The car made 425whp on their dyno(awd dyno dynamics)which is notorious for reading @15% lower than a dynojet. The motor is stock except for cams. GT 30/37 .63ar turbo, modified hks manifold. I'm really not into dsm but I went for a ride in this car and it is straight vicious on the street.
